I don't know about HH specifically. The park ranger interviewed about the attack at Pensacola said that they notice daily shark activity there, and that people should not be in the water at dawn or dusk since this is feeding time for the sharks. The child was attacked around 8 p.m. I would ask the lifeguards at the beach about what they are seeing. Hope this helps.
